The Intel Core i5-2400S is a quad-core processor tailored for small form factor desktops that cannot accommodate standard 95W cooling solutions. By maintaining four physical cores but lowering the base and turbo frequencies compared to the standard i5-2400, Intel achieved a 65W thermal envelope. It lacks Hyper-Threading, a defining characteristic of non-K Sandy Bridge i5 processors, meaning it handles four threads natively. Equipped with 6 MB of shared L3 cache and Intel HD 2000 graphics, it provided a balanced blend of multi-core productivity and low-power operation for home and office PCs during its prime.

Do Intel Core i5-2400S and Intel Core i5-2500S use the same socket?

Yes — all of these CPUs use the LGA 1155 socket, so they share compatible motherboards.
